1. Practically an acre.
The phrase “practically an acre” offers a readily comprehensible benchmark for the substantial space represented by 40,800 sq. ft. One acre equates to 43,560 sq. ft; subsequently, 40,800 sq. ft falls simply in need of a full acre, representing roughly 93.6% of this generally understood unit. This comparability permits people to conceptualize the magnitude of the realm in query, notably these accustomed to land measurements in agricultural or rural contexts. As an illustration, understanding {that a} explicit plot is almost an acre can rapidly inform selections concerning its suitability for a selected agricultural goal, the potential yield of a given crop, or the house required for livestock.
The distinction between 40,800 sq. ft and a full acre, whereas seemingly small in proportion phrases, interprets to a big 2,760 sq. ft. 2. 0.936 acres.
0.936 acres represents the exact conversion of 40,800 sq. ft right into a extra readily grasped unit of land space. This conversion makes use of the usual equivalence of 1 acre being equal to 43,560 sq. ft. Query 1: How does 40,800 sq. ft evaluate to an acre?
40,800 sq. ft is roughly 0.936 acres. One acre equals 43,560 sq. ft.
